What is
hochschule dual?

hochschule dual is not a university of applied sciences, but the umbrella brand for cooperative study option in Bavaria. The initiative brings all the cooperative degree programmes together on one central information platform and also acts as a service point for prospective students, universities of applied sciences, and companies.

As an umbrella brand with uniform quality standards, hochschule dual oversees and provides information about all the cooperative study programmes offered by the universities of applied sciences in Bavaria.


What does "dual" mean?

“Dual” is a protected term in Germany, meaning it combines two learning locations: studying at a university of applied sciences (UAS) while gaining practical experience in an enterprise or institution.

There are three models:

  • In an academic degree programme with intensive in-company training (Studium mit vertiefter Praxis), you can complete your studies after 3.5 years with a bachelor‘s degree and gain comprehensive practical work experience in a participating enterprise along the way. This means that you can demonstrate longer periods of practical work experience than graduates of standard degree programmes.
    You will be involved in enterprise projects, ideally in different departments, and with time, you may even be able to take on your own small projects. You also write your bachelor dissertation in the enterprise.
  • A dual master’s programme combines advanced academic study with practical work experience in an enterprise. You study part-time at a university of applied sciences while also working in a relevant position and applying your knowledge directly in practice. The programme usually lasts for two years. Your master’s thesis is often written in cooperation with the company and with a focus on real-world projects or challenges.
     
  • You can combine academic study leading to a bachelor’s degree with an advanced vocational training qualification in a cooperative degree programme (Verbundstudium) that lasts for 4.5 years.
    If you choose this model, you will attend vocational school and work in-company as a trainee in the first year of the programme and then then start your academic degree and divide your time between university studies and in-company training. You will take the examination for your vocational qualification during your practical semester.

Degrees are available in the following areas:

  • Engineering
  • Business and economics
  • IT, mathematics, and the natural sciences
  • Design
  • Social welfare work and healthcare
  • Agriculture and forestry.
     

The path to a 
dual degree programme

In order to begin a dual study programme,
certain formal requirements must be met:

  • University entrance qualification: In general, applicants are required to have a university entrance qualification (Fachhochschulreife), a master craftsman’s examination, or, in certain cases, completed vocational training with relevant professional experience.
  • Education or training contract: You must have a contract with a partner company of a university of applied sciences (UAS) in Bavaria.
  • Numerus clausus (NC): Some degree programmes have restricted admission. The admission threshold (NC) varies depending on the university and the specific programme. The same NC requirements apply to dual study degree as to regular ones. For detailed information, please contact the respective university directly.


Personal requirements
In addition to the formal requirements, applicants are expected to work hard, take personal responsibility, demonstrate good organisational skills, and be motivated to complete their studies successfully and with commitment.


Checklist
How to succeed in
the application process

Why German is key for your dual degree

A profound knowledge of German is essential, as it’s the main language used in most companies. You’ll need it to communicate with colleagues, follow instructions, and succeed in your practical training alongside your studies.

Select a study model

  • Study programme with in-depth practical experience (bachelor's/master's): Combines a degree programme with intensive practical phases at a partner company (3.5 years)

  • Combined study programme (bachelor's): Combines a degree programme with vocational training (4.5 years)

Select a degree programme

Which degree programme is your favourite? If there are several options, prioritise them for yourself.

If you don't know what you want to study yet, we recommend taking the free study interest test offered by Hochschulkompasses. 

Select your university

Select your preferred university from 20 member institutions that offer your degree programme.

Not particular about where you study?
Then feel free to skip ahead and pick your partner company first.

Find your partner company

Discover which partner companies have vacancies for your selected degree programme.
Instructions can be found below under “How do I find a partner company?”

It is also possible to recruit a new partner company that does not yet participate in a dual study programme.
For this, please contact the university where you wish to study.

Apply to the partner company

Ideally, you should apply to a partner company one year before the startof your studies.
It is recommended to submit applications to several partner companies simultaneously.

Note: The combined degree programme begins with 12 to 14 months of continuous practical training. After this first year, the academic programme starts, with university phases alternating with periods of practical training at the partner company during semester breaks, similar to the degree programme with in-depth practical training.

Sign a contract

Once you have received confirmation from a partner company, sign a training contract with the company, institution, or business. This contract governs the cooperation between dual students and partner companies.

In a combined study programme, you will also sign an additional training contract that specifically governs the training phases.

Sample contracts can be found on the German version of the website under “Downloads.”

Apply to the university

Apply with your completed training contract to a university that cooperates with your partner company in the chosen degree programme.

Application deadlines:

  • For studies beginning in the winter semester: application period from April to July.

  • For studies beginning in the summer semester: application period from November to January.

You can find more detailed information, including specific deadlines, on the website of the respective university.

Enrol at the university

Once you have received confirmation from your university, you must enrol within the specified period.

Note: If you are enrolled in a combined degree programme and will therefore spend the first year at a company, do not enrol immediately. Instead, contact your university to request a deferral until the following year – that is, the year in which your first academic phase at the university begins. A deferral will reserve your place at the university for one year, allowing you to enrol at the appropriate time.

What are the benefits
of cooperative degrees?

Extensive practical relevance: Close integration between the theoretical knowledge gained from the university degree and the practical experience gathered in the company or institution.

Double qualification: The cooperative degree programmes linking academic and vocational training each lead to two state-recognised qualifications in 4.5 years, a bachelor’s degree and a vocational qualification.

 

Remuneration from the company.

 

The public UAS do not charge any fees.


A high likelihood of gaining a permanent position at the company and outstanding career opportunities.


Gaining key skills: Time management, self-organisation, structured working, communication strategies, teamwork, conflict management, and much more.

Find dual degree programmes
or Partner Companies

Start with our dual degree programmes portal: search all dual degree programmes at our 20 member universities and see companies currently offering placements.

Other ways to find a partner company:

  • Ask your university which companies they already work with.
  • Check online job portals like StepStone, Monster, or the Federal Employment Agency.
  • Visit company career pages for dual degree opportunities.
  • Attend education and career fairs to meet companies directly.
  • Take the initiative and find a suitable enterprise organization, or social institution yourself.

Note: Companies must meet certain requirements and sign a cooperation agreement with the university to become a practical partner.

Need help? Dual coordinators at the universities provide guidance, tips, and checklists for new practical partners.
